Paul Catherall primarily uses linoleum and woodblock printing techniques for his artwork, creating bold, graphic images. He often employs vibrant colors and a distinct style that emphasizes geometric forms and architectural elements. His choice of materials and methods allows for a striking interplay of light and shadow, enhancing the visual impact of his pieces.
